Russian Ambassador Under Informal Detention in Kabul

The Russian Ambassador to Kabul, Dmitry Zhirnov, is under strict surveillance by the Taliban, requiring security escorts and time logs for even routine diplomatic visits, according to leaked intelligence documents.

Kokcha News Agency – Classified documents from the Taliban’s intelligence department (Directorate 069) reveal that the Russian Ambassador to Afghanistan, Dmitry Zhirnov, is effectively under informal detention. For any movement, including visits to the Turkish Embassy, he must be accompanied by a security escort, and his departure and return times are meticulously recorded.

On August 25, 2025, Ambassador Zhirnov’s visit to the Turkish Embassy was logged as follows:
-*Departure: 9:00 AM
– Return: 2:30 PM
– Purpose of Visit: “Tasosra” (likely related to security consultations or espionage matters).

The Taliban forwarded this report to Directorate 061, indicating that they view every move by the Russian Ambassador as a potential security threat rather than a diplomatic partner.

This level of scrutiny underscores the deteriorating relationship between Moscow and the Taliban.
